Adam's Apples
a tragicomedy by Anders Thomas Jensen
director: Béla Paczolay

An adaptation of the Danish cult film in which the neo-nazi Adam, sentenced to community service in a countryside church, finds himself in the company of a Pakistani robber, a kleptomanic alcoholic, a desperate, troublemaking pregnant young woman and a charismatic priest who blindly believes in goodness of man. And the black comedy is about to begin...

A magical meeting of two anniversaries on the Müpa Budapest stage: the Talamba Percussion Group is celebrating its 25th anniversary this year with a 21st-century arrangement of a piano cycle by Mussorgsky's piano cycle Pictures of an Exhibition as it turns 150 itself: following on the heels of Emerson, Lake & Palmer and Isao Tomita with their versions, they are presenting their own take on the 19th-century masterpiece, this one revised for percussion and electronica, and featuring DJ Bootsie.
